Expenses
While the costs of opening up a gold IRA account are reasonably reduced, you need to bear in mind that there are numerous additional expenses related to it. These costs may include a single account creation cost of $50 to $300, storage space and insurance policy costs, and also yearly administrative costs. Taking a look at the various prices related to a gold IRA can help you choose the most effective alternative for your needs as well as economic budget plan.
The cost of establishing a gold IRA account relies on the kind of account you want to open up. Some accounts bill yearly upkeep charges that can vary from $150 to $300. You'll also require to pay a depository fee, which normally ranges from $175 to $225 each year. These costs are separate from the spread and also are billed by the manager who promotes your deals. Generally, though, fees for buying and selling precious metals will certainly set you back in between $50 as well as $125 per deal.
